Research interests

My research focuses on child protection systems, particularly the interaction between law and social work, and local authorities and courts, empirically using quantiative and qualitative methods and through contextual socio-legal analysis.  I have undertaken major empirical studies on  emergency intervention in child protection; care proceedings, including legal aid costs; parental representation in care proceedings;  the operation and impact of the pre-proceedings process for care proceedings; and the reforms to care proceedings and their impact on children's outcomes.   My empirical research uses mixed methods, combining quantitative and qualitative approaches and has included ethnography, action research and data linkage with the main databases for children's social care. In addition I undertake doctrinal analysis of child law and its development nationally and internationally. I am currntly working on a study of Dicharge of Care Orders, funded by the Nuffield Foundation.
